11 Spring 2018 Handbag Trends

1. Micro Bags

Whether you’re going to shop designer bags or not, you can’t not appreciate the minimalism of this trend! In Spring Summer 2018 collections, almost all design houses like Moschino, Valentino, Dior, Salvatore Ferragamo, Dolce & Gabbana, etc. couldn’t resist themselves from bringing back the micro bags. As predicted in the handbag trends for 2017 Fall collections, the trend of micro bag became a big hit this season. We’re saw sling, small handle and handheld micro bags in the SS18 collections.

2. Thin Bags

Go for the slimmest bags this season. The slimmer the trendier! This is one of the newest styles in trendy designer bags we spotted in the Spring 2018 collections. Thin bags are perfect for casual outings and dates when you want a sleek look. From sling to flap to fringed, all varieties of thin bags were seen. I loved the paper-thin pink one by Dolce & Gabbana which would enhance any party look.

3. Multi Strap Bags

Multi-straps are also one of the fresh trends we’re seeing in Spring Summer 2018 collections. The designers kept one of the straps embellished or different colored, making the bags look unique and trendy. The reason for multi-strap bags is a mystery to me because I don’t see how it’s practical. Waiting for the bags to hit the stores for the mystery to be solved!

4. Oversized Clutch

Ditch those tiny clutches.The oversized clutch is the new thing.  Both printed and plain ones are trendy. Go for the foot long ones or larger. From Alberta Ferretti to Prada to Chanel, designers are drooling over this trend. I’m loving the Roberto Cavalli one that matched with the print on the dress. So cool it is!

5. Sling Bag with Chain Strap

You may already own a sling bag but the ones with chain strap were runway favorites this season. Chain strap sling bags with a length of anywhere between hip to thighs are trendy. Opt either for leather, plain, iridescent, or printed ones!




6. Mini Backpacks

One of my favorite 2018 handbag trends it is. Aw! They are so cute to look at, especially the Moschino one! Backpacks have been a must-have accessory in 2017 as they are super comfortable to carry. We saw both normal sized and mini backpacks in Spring 2018 collections. Enhance your street style look, girls!

7. Laptop Bags

Great news! Your work bag no longer needs to be boring. And you don’t need to carry a laptop bag along with another bag. This season, designers have come up with ladies’ big bags that can accommodate the laptop and other handbag essentials too! Long elongated bags are what we saw in the SS18 collections. Go either for minimal prints or plain to get the sophisticated office look.

 

8. Bucket Bags

Bucket bags are back this season! We’re seeing bucket bags with long and short straps. Both party and casual ones were seen on the runways in the collections of Alexander Wang, Fendi, Chanel, etc. Plain, woven and sequined bucket bags are trendy. Personally, I  don’t like this trend because they look bulky and shapeless.

 

9. Double Bags

If you love designer handbags, why carry just one?! The trend of double bags is not fading away, so invest in this one! There’s a vast difference between the double bags we saw last season and the ones we’re seeing now. This season, we saw pairings like one clutch with a coin purse, double backpacks, tote with clutch and thin double bags.

10. Fringe Bags

Fringe handbags were the #1 trend in the handbag trends for Fall but this season they lost its place and are on #10. Nonetheless, here they are! Fringes all over the bags are completely out. We’re seeing tassels too. Fringes at the sides or bottom of the bags are trendy!

11. Transparent Bags

Here’s the coolest trend we’ve spotted in 2018’s designer shoes and handbags. Transparent accessories have been a big thing on the Spring 2018 runways. We saw transparent bags in the collections of Chanel, Fendi, Valentino, etc. From tote to structured to sling, go for the transparent ones!

 

What’s Out

  1. This season, it’s all about making a statement. Ditch those plain strapped plain bags immediately.
  2. Very large backpacks are paving the way for the smaller versions. Oversized backpacks are out!
  3. Denim and suede bags are also out. So sorry girls if you own either of them!
  4. Slim U-shaped clutches are a complete no no! Go for micro bags or oversized clutches instead.
